together, Similarly--a more dificulė task, --the various, boats trading to the port wers olawibed according to the nature of their cargo or place of registration, and the numerous face leviable on each class were marged into one perment.

After giving examples of amalgamating the various feprontargs, Mr Carey con- tinues." Thas, an unlicensed boat ou entering with a cargo of salt fish paid,, benidos tariff duty on her cargo, six, espar- ate fees, Boma óf which were variable; in addition, she was subject to package and license fees which had to be calculated in oino different ways, according to whether she carried 10, 20, 30, or more pioule. By the revised method the same bost now paya & fixed license fee of Ts, 0.90, and TL0,18:4* en 'every pical of her targo. Broadly speaking, amalgamation consisted, as may be seen, in lumping the fees to- getber, and reducing the total, to round figaros for grantor convenience in caleal tion. Where this proques, owing to too grent a variety of charcos, was impracti cable, an average of the feas luviablé was taken and a rate favourable to the majority appliants sufopfod, Alldrance was made, where necessary, for the system of rebates that formerly existed; and the fact that certain goods enjoyed preferential rates was also taken into consideration. As result, the revised, foes, whilst not bo elastic as they ure under the ancien régitze do not differ in the aggregato frum what? tradere have been accustomed to pay from time.immemorial. It may be argued that A revision of the tariff itself would have been better than amalgamation of fece, and mere in accordance with mudurn eo nomie ideas But bosides the fact that this was beyond our power locally, some of the fees leviod are equivalent to tonnage dúce on reanuls, and would not therefore come with in the range of duty revision. Moreover, at several of our branch stations a tariff duties are levied, but moroly fees, pattek- ing of the nature of octroi, on domestic produce passing from place to place within |

the infer.

Other improvements followed the are algamation of leas. The oxchan:o care of the doilar was properly adjusted. Former ly it variod at the different stations between 010 and 1,000 cash; it is now accepted st All our aflees in payment of duties at the Girod rate of 1,108 cash. A book showing. in local currency, the duties and fees leviabie on ovory sticle ugasily imparted or export-

ed, and the dues on every beat entering | the inlet, was prepared, and is on sale to the public. The numerous cubicles forming the old office were done away with: durios and foes are now paid as one place and in one eum, the now method permitting every applicant-bo know exactly what he has to pay sud that he is being cor- reatly dealt with. The time saved in calculation is Cosnsideráble, and traders are no longer subjected to annoying delays. The staff was farther reduced: it now consists of 70 employés, who are comfortably house and well paid. The cost of collection is kept within a roagonable limits, and Do longer the division of an excessive surplus among a f parasitic drones. It would be, swarm of perhaps, too much to assort that irregula Aities do not exist, but their scope is

ertsibly extremely limited.

In 1905, the fourth year of our administration, the Native Customb revenue renched Tle. 61,897--more than seven times the amount formerly romitted to the Government. This excellent result must be attributed to an ihoreasingly! affective Duotrol, to the introduction of salutary reforms, and to the growing senso of confidence among traders which more business-like methods have inspired."
